Internet Safety Tips for Kids

Kids and Internet- Security Tips

Internet educates, positively influences and provides a creative outlet for today’s kids. But internet can be a confusing and dangerous place too.Internet stalkers and predators are taking advantage of families that are not aware of basic internet safety rules.With right precautions we can safeguard our kids. The following tips will guide parent’s to provide a safe browsing world for our kids.

I. Create separate user accounts

a) Create limited access User Accounts for Kids.

b) Never give administrator privilege for kids.

II. Use age appropriate browsers

a) Use Kid browsers like KidZui, Buddy browser etc.

b) Adjust web browser security settings

III. Block/filter contents – Age wise

a) Use parental control feature in Windows 7, Vista & XP

b) Use software’s like Windows Live Family Safety, K9 Kid protection etc

IV. Set download Limit for kids

a) Use router with QoS capability

They Will Always Keep These Favorite Kid Gifts

We all know that when a baby is born, any personalized gifts that are received will be cherished for years to come. It becomes more challenging to purchase items that hold a similar value as children age. However, there are those special gifts for kids that become keepsakes, just like personalized kids gifts, that will be treasured in adulthood after many years of use. The key is to find those favorite kid gifts.

FOR GIRLS

- A baby doll is a sure hit for two to six year olds. There are lifelike and interactive dolls available today. Even a typical baby doll could become the closest companion for a younger girl. The same is true for stuffed animals. When my sister was about four years old, she forgot her stuffed duck named “Ducky” at a hotel. We had to turn around to go pick it up after we left and had already driven about 200 miles. This is a perfect example of how important stuffed animals can be to a young child.

- For girls aged three to eight, consider a dollhouse. There are so many miniature pieces of furniture to choose from today that the possibilities are endless for decorating.
